What material is required if not using flex duct for electric dryer vents?

Explanation:
When it comes to venting electric dryers, using a duct with a smooth interior surface is crucial for optimal airflow and efficiency. A metal duct with a smooth inside surface minimizes friction as the warm, moist air travels through it. This design helps prevent lint buildup, which can be a fire hazard, and allows for better exhaust flow, reducing drying times and improving the appliance's efficiency. Choosing metal for dryer vents is vital because metal can withstand higher temperatures compared to plastic, which may warp or melt under heat. Additionally, metal ducts are more durable and resistant to damage, ensuring a longer lifespan than alternatives. The smooth interior is particularly important; it prevents lint from catching on rough surfaces, thereby reducing clogs and maintenance. Other materials, like plastic, may not hold up well in terms of temperature tolerance and durability, making them less suitable for dryer venting. Meanwhile, while flexible metal ducts do offer some convenience in installation, they typically require a smooth interior as well to ensure that they function effectively. In this context, the best option combines the essential qualities of durability and smooth airflow, making a metal duct with a smooth inside the ideal choice for electric dryer vents.

The Smooth Operator: Metal Duct with a Smooth Inside

Alright, here’s the straightforward scoop: if you’re not going with flex duct for your electric dryer vent, the clear winner is metal duct with a smooth inside surface. Why is that? It comes down to two key players—airflow and efficiency—both critical to getting that laundry done without any hiccups.

Think about it this way: when warm, moist air travels through a duct, a smooth interior helps reduce friction. Consequently, the air moves more freely, allowing for faster drying times. And let’s face it, who doesn’t want to avoid the unpleasant chore of re-running that spin cycle because the clothes are still damp?

But it’s not just about speed. Using a metal duct also minimizes the risk of lint buildup. Lingering lint isn’t just an eyesore; it can be dangerous too. Many homeowners don’t realize that lint is a major fire hazard. A smooth duct allows lint to flow through instead of snagging and building up. Talk about peace of mind!

Why Metal Over Plastic?

Now, you might be tempted to think, “Hey, plastic ducting sounds easier!” And it can be—but not necessarily better. Here’s the deal: metal can withstand much higher temperatures than plastic. Picture this: you’ve got your dryer cranking out heat to dry those clothes, and if that heat is too much for plastic, it could warp or even melt. Yikes!

Additionally, metal ducts are generally more durable. Whether it’s the wear and tear from frequent use or just life throwing curveballs your way, metal can take it. Meanwhile, plastic ducts might not have that same resilience, which could lead to replacements more often than you’d like. It’s all about making that one-time investment worth it in the long run.
